The starbord water tank on our '84 C30 has developed a leak. It's on the bottom where the tank sits on the support block. I've removed the tank but don't know what to use to seal the leak. Any suggestions?

leak repair

I had the same problem on my 1983 C30 this summer. I roughed up the bottom of the tank with course grit sand paper where it was leaking, and then fiberglassed over the crack. So far, no more problems with it.

I Bought New Tank

Pete, I had the same failure in my C36 -- the flat-bottomed tank was parked on a slight bulge in the hull and after many years of stress, it finally cracked. I was told that because the tank is made of polyethlene, no permanent repair is possible. Kind of like Teflon, nothing "sticks" permanently and well to polyethlene. Catalina put me in touch with the tank vendor, Ronco Plastics, who confirmed this, saying that even the hose connections are "spun" in at such a high speed that the poly gets hot, melts and fuses to them. Glueing is not possible. The new tank cost me $175 and they made it and delivered it to my door in three days time. I suppose you could try a cheap repair and with winter coming on, there's time to try it, and you're not out much if it doesn't work.
